Understanding Vicks: A Brief Overview

Vicks is a well-known brand that offers a variety of over-the-counter products designed to relieve symptoms of colds, coughs, and congestion. The most popular among these is Vicks VapoRub, a topical ointment containing menthol, camphor, and eucalyptus oil. These ingredients work together to provide a soothing sensation and help alleviate respiratory discomfort.

The brand has expanded its product line to include various forms such as cough syrups, throat lozenges, and nasal sprays. Each product is formulated with specific ingredients aimed at targeting different symptoms associated with respiratory illnesses. While many people use Vicks products without any issues, concerns occasionally arise regarding their safety.

The Ingredients: What’s Inside Vicks?

The effectiveness of Vicks products lies in their active ingredients. Here’s a breakdown of some key components commonly found in Vicks formulations:

Ingredient Function
Menthol Provides a cooling sensation and acts as a mild analgesic.
Camphor Helps relieve pain and congestion by acting as a counterirritant.
Eucalyptus Oil Aids in clearing nasal passages and has antiseptic properties.
Pine Oil Offers additional soothing properties and helps reduce inflammation.

Each ingredient serves a specific purpose, contributing to the overall effectiveness of the product. However, understanding how these ingredients work is essential for safe usage.

The Risks of Misuse: Can Vicks Kill You?

While Vicks products are generally safe for most people when used as directed, misuse can lead to serious health complications. Overdosing on topical applications or ingesting the product can be particularly dangerous.

For instance, camphor is toxic when ingested in large amounts. Symptoms of camphor poisoning include nausea, vomiting, seizures, and even respiratory distress. The risk is especially high for young children who might accidentally consume the ointment or apply it excessively.

Additionally, using Vicks on broken skin or applying it too liberally can cause skin irritation or allergic reactions. It’s crucial to follow the usage instructions provided on the packaging to minimize these risks.

Specific Populations at Risk

Certain groups may be more susceptible to adverse reactions from Vicks products:

Children

Children under two years old should not use topical mentholated ointments like Vicks due to the risk of respiratory distress. Parents should consult with a pediatrician before using any over-the-counter medications on young children.

Pregnant Women

Pregnant women should exercise caution when using any medication, including topical treatments like Vicks. Although there’s limited research on the effects of menthol during pregnancy, it’s wise to consult healthcare providers about safety before use.

Individuals with Pre-existing Conditions

People with respiratory conditions such as asthma may experience exacerbated symptoms from certain ingredients in Vicks products. Always consult with a healthcare professional if you have underlying health issues before using these products.

Safe Usage Guidelines for Vicks Products

To enjoy the benefits of Vicks without risking your health, it’s essential to follow some straightforward guidelines:

    • Read Labels: Always read the instructions and warnings on the product label before use.
    • Avoid Overuse: Do not apply more than recommended; excessive use can lead to adverse effects.
    • Avoid Ingestion: Keep all products out of reach of children to prevent accidental ingestion.
    • Sensitive Areas: Avoid applying on broken skin or near sensitive areas like the eyes or mouth.

These simple precautions can help ensure that you use Vicks safely and effectively.
